16494780896304 has 80 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 43728140303232. Its totient is φ = 5354916908544.
The previous prime is 16494780896273. The next prime is 16494780896317. The reversal of 16494780896304 is 40369808749461.
It is a happy number.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(19)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 15 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 10799149 + ... + 12231564.
Almost surely, 216494780896304 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
16494780896304 is an ab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ors (27233359406928).
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
16494780896304 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
16494780896304 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 23031114 (or 23031108 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 250822656, while the sum is 69.
